When one of the (lighter) alt-rock stations in my area turned into a top 40 station (and got the rick dees morning show, PAIN) they did the turn around near thanksgiving, and I remember driving home for the holiday, and they played the grinch song ("You're a mean one, Mr. Grinch) for something like 2 straight days, until after the holiday was over.
It was my favorite station, too. I was PISSED.

Then when the Edge went out here, they played "end of the world as we know it" for a whole day.

It's a pretty common thing to do apparently. Try and drown your happy memories of the station with the annoyance of listening to one song over and over, so when the new format kicks in you'll listen just because it's not that one damn song.
